While only three of the ten tracks are live, this is still a much more satisfying album than Peggy Scott-Adams previous efforts. Of the three live tracks (performed in Montgomery, Alabama), two suspiciously don't sound all-the-way-live, but they're still enjoyable slices of Southern soul seductively executed in Scott-Adams husky, deep-throated delivery. The seven studio cuts are all worthy, but lack the sweetening horns that define the type of music she's portraying. Peggy emulates Betty Wright on "I'm Getting What I Want," but displays her own unique persona on the rest.
